ShadowBroker is an open source geospatial intelligence dashboard designed to aggregate public telemetry and OSINT feeds into one unified interface. The project is built using Next.js, FastAPI, Python, Rust, and MapLibre GL, with deployment support through Docker and Kubernetes.
ShadowBroker is one of the most talked about open source intelligence projects currently circulating in cybersecurity, OSINT, and self hosted communities. The platform combines aircraft tracking, satellite telemetry, maritime data, GPS jamming detection, geopolitical events, and surveillance feeds into a single real time dashboard that feels closer to a cyberpunk command center than a traditional analytics tool.
The software tracks aircraft, ships, satellites, earthquakes, conflict zones, GPS interference, CCTV networks, radio nodes, and geopolitical incidents in real time using publicly available APIs and data sources.
The creator describes it as a decentralized intelligence platform focused on making publicly accessible telemetry easier to visualize and analyze.
Key Features of ShadowBroker
Real Time Global Tracking
ShadowBroker can display live aircraft, maritime vessels, satellite orbits, seismic events, and conflict related overlays on an interactive map.Cyberpunk Style Interface
The UI intentionally resembles cinematic intelligence systems with satellite imagery, tactical overlays, multiple visual modes, and dark themed dashboards.Massive OSINT Feed Aggregation
The platform combines dozens of public intelligence feeds into a single interface, reducing the need to jump between multiple websites and APIs.Self Hosted Deployment
Users can run the entire platform locally using Docker Compose or Kubernetes, giving advanced users more control over infrastructure and privacy.AI Agent Integration
ShadowBroker includes experimental support for AI driven analysis systems capable of identifying patterns and correlations across multiple data streams.Advanced Intelligence Layers
The software supports layers such as GPS jamming zones, SAR satellite imagery, conflict reports, CCTV feeds, and geopolitical monitoring tools.

⚡ Quick Start (Docker)
git clone https://github.com/bigbodycobain/Shadowbroker.git
cd Shadowbroker
docker compose pull
docker compose up -dOpen http://localhost:3000 to view the dashboard! (Requires Docker Desktop or Docker Engine)
Backend port already in use? The browser only needs port
3000, but the backend API is also published on host port8000for local diagnostics. If another app already uses8000, create or edit.envnext todocker-compose.ymland setBACKEND_PORT=8001, then rundocker compose up -d.
Blank news/UAP/bases/wastewater after several minutes? Check for backend OOM restarts with
docker events --since 30m --filter container=shadowbroker-backend --filter event=oom. The default compose file gives the backend 4GB; if your host has less memory, reduce enabled feeds or setBACKEND_MEMORY_LIMIT=3Gand expect slower/heavier layers to warm more gradually.
Podman users: Podman works, but
podman composeis a wrapper and still needs a Compose provider installed. On Windows/WSL, if you seelooking up compose provider failed, installpodman-composeand runpodman-compose pullfollowed bypodman-compose up -dfrom inside the clonedShadowbrokerfolder. On Linux/macOS/WSL shells you can also use./compose.sh --engine podman pulland./compose.sh --engine podman up -d.
User Experience
ShadowBroker delivers one of the most visually impressive open source OSINT interfaces currently available. The dashboard feels immersive and highly interactive, especially for users interested in cybersecurity, aviation tracking, geopolitics, and intelligence analysis.
Community reactions on Reddit and GitHub have been overwhelmingly enthusiastic, with many users describing it as a “FOSS Palantir” style platform for public intelligence monitoring.
However, the software is clearly designed for advanced users. Initial setup requires Docker knowledge, API configuration, and familiarity with self hosted environments. Beginners may struggle with deployment and troubleshooting.
Performance and Stability
Performance is impressive considering the amount of real time telemetry being processed. The application uses viewport culling, clustering, compression, and GPU accelerated rendering to keep the interface responsive.
Still, because the project is evolving rapidly, users occasionally encounter bugs, API failures, CSS rendering issues, or compatibility problems depending on deployment environment and hardware. Community feedback shows active fixes and rapid iteration from contributors.
Privacy and Ethical Concerns
ShadowBroker only aggregates publicly available data, but its capabilities naturally raise ethical and privacy questions.
The platform can track private jets, surveillance feeds, military aircraft activity, and geopolitical movements in near real time. Critics argue that consolidating these feeds into one accessible interface increases surveillance accessibility, even if the data itself is technically public.
The developers emphasize that the project does not use classified or hacked information and operates entirely on OSINT sources.
